Full job description
At Atlas Physical Therapy, it is our mission to provide outstanding orthopedic, sports medicine and pelvic health Physical Therapy and rehabilitation to the greater Denver Metro area to keep Coloradans active, healthy, and doing what they love to do. As outdoor enthusiasts, we understand the comprehensive health benefits that the Colorado lifestyle provides and wish to aid all who want to continue enjoying it to do so with optimal health and performance.
Atlas Physical Therapy is growing again! This is a position where you will see mostly orthopedic conditions with pelvic floor patients as well. We are a busy orthopedic clinic with a heavy spine and sports medicine population aged 15-45 with a diverse orthopedic population.
Grow your career with exciting pathways into management and clinic ownership, backed by unlimited earning potential and zero income caps. You will have the opportunity to elevate your clinical expertise through personalized mentorship while collaborating closely with an experienced, highly skilled team dedicated to your ongoing professional success.
Excellent pay, weekly and monthly mentoring and a fantastic patient population. Opportunity for high level mentoring from four highly experienced therapists. Schedule flexibility with four, ten hour days (or 5, 8's) with great 401k match, 3+ weeks of PTO, paid holidays, continuing education, and full benefits.

The anticipated base salary range for this position is $90,000- $110,000+. Salary is based on various factors, including relevant experience, knowledge, skills, other job-related qualifications, and geography. Additionally, this position is eligible for discretionary incentive compensation. The Company's incentive compensation plan is subject to change. Medical, dental, vision, 401(k), paid time off, and other benefits are also available, subject to the terms of the Company's plan.
